On the other hand, if there are GPL and non-GPL libraries that provide
the same interface, the program is only GPL when it's using (or being
distributed with) the GPL library, and it can be non-GPL for just the
source code with no libraries or when using the non-GPL library. (Or
it can still be GPL, if the code's author wants it to be GPL and the
non-GPL library's license is compatible.)
